Performing a Manual Calibration

To manually calibrate an analog output:
(1)
Use the Application > Analog Outputs menu path to access this function.
(2)
The Analog Outputs dialog box appears.
(3)
Select the desired analog output by clicking anywhere in the corresponding row.
(4)
Set the Zero Scale and Full Scale values as desired.
(5)
Set the Fixed/Var parameter to "Fixed".
(6)
Set Fixed Value equal to the Zero Scale value.
(7)
Set Zero Adjustment and Full Adjustment to "0.0".
Setting both adjustment values to "0.0" disables the scale adjustment.
(8)
Click on the OK button to accept your changes and exit from the Analog Outputs dialog box.
